Ugglan Boule & Bar
Ugglan is one of our favorite places in Stockholm for grown-up fun and games. With activities like boule, shuffleboard, and ping pong, it’s already a blast – and now, thanks to our partnership, you can also borrow board games from their in-house library! You’ll find the games in both the main bar and the cozy German Bar.
Playing is free, just remember to return the games when you’re done. And if there’s a game you’d love to see added to the collection – let the staff know!

Hop & Vine / Fox in a Box
Just down the street from our store on Sveavägen 118, you’ll find Hop & Vine – a cozy wine bar, board game café, and escape room all in one! Upstairs, you can enjoy great food and drinks while playing from their collection of board games, many of which come from us at Dragon’s Lair. As long as you keep ordering, playing is free. Otherwise, a small gaming fee applies to help keep their game library fresh and growing.
Looking for a different kind of challenge? They also offer a portable escape room that can be played right in the bar or in a private room.

SMASH Gaming Association
Looking to join a welcoming board game group? We warmly recommend our friends at SMASH! Every Wednesday (except during summer), they meet at Folkes café in Huddinge Centrum from 6 PM until closing. It’s free to join in, and everyone’s welcome – whether you're new to the hobby or a seasoned gamer.
They also host the annual convention SMASHCON, where members can win some great prizes!

Leksaksbiblioteket Stockholm
We’re proud to support Leksaksbiblioteket – a wonderful initiative where families can borrow toys instead of buying new ones. Based in Bagarmossen, this toy library gives games and toys a longer life, helping reduce both waste and costs. We’ve happily donated a few board games to their collection, now available to borrow just like books at a regular library.
You’ll find them at Bagarmossens Folkets Hus – open on Tuesdays 1–5 PM, Wednesdays 1–6 PM, and Saturdays 10 AM–3 PM.
